Oil prices surged approximately 4% as tensions escalated with Iran reportedly preparing a missile attack on Israel. This geopolitical distress also caused a significant dip in the S&P 500, with technology stocks like Apple, Nvidia, and Microsoft weighing down the index and the Cboe Volatility Index reaching its highest level in nearly a month.
